4.5/5 stars* “I’ve wanted this every single night for six months. Probably farther back than that. You’ve always been the unattainable girl of my dreams, Ellie.” “When I asked you, ‘what about us,’ you said, ‘There is no us. There’s never been an us.’ I wanted to show you it wasn’t true. That there’s always been an us.” So, when i read Ignite, I wasn't that excited to read Ellie and Gianni's story, but to be honest, once i started I couldn't stop, they were addictive and hot and emotional and beautiful and they had a lot of history already and it was so good! I really loved Ellie's character and her stubbornness and her love for what she does and also her grow, because she wanted to be like her mom and never thought she could but she is and so much more, she is her own person and when life got a little side tracked and happened something she wasn't expecting, she was so strong and she is also so funny!! Gianni tho, i liked him right from the start, I even liked him since Ignite to be honest, he was always getting on Ellie's skin and it was so fun, but in his book I got to meet him deeply and he is so much more than a hottie chef, he truly cares deeply and he left his life behind to come home to help his family who mean the world to him! He also had a beautiful strong grow from a person who never wanted to settle down in one place and have a significant other to someone who couldn't live without Ellie and needed to set up and be the man they knew he could be and he did it!! Their banter was just so good and hot since the first page and then the chemistry they have, even tho they thought they didn't really liked each other, was truly out of this world!! I loved how they have so much history because they grow up together (not always friendly with each other because Gianni was always messing with Ellie for fun but in a funny cute way of his) and their parents are best friends, I think their connection runs really deep and it was so wonderful and magical to see! Now, I am ready to finally read Felicity's book aaa with that billionaire that Ellie said he was a little shy uhh interesting!! But seriously overall, I think I liked Taste and Ellie and Gianni a little bit more than Ignite but seeing Winnie again ugh my baby the cutest woman ever, it was amazing!!! “You’re here. I want to be where you are.” “I love you, Ellie.” His voice was soft and serious. “I have never said those words to anyone before. And now that I know what it should feel like, I’m glad I didn’t, because it would have been a lie.” He looked at me the way I’d always dreamed of. “You’re everything to me. You’re the one.” “There will always be an us.”
